Northrop Grumman, Strategic Space Systems Division, has an opening for a Senior Principal Materials & Processes (M&P) Engineer specializing in metals and metallic processes, to join our team of qualified, diverse individuals. This position will be located in Redondo Beach, California . Responsibilities may include, but are not limited to: Performs root cause analysis of material failures Provides effective solutions to production metallics issues Generates test plans & reports Analyzes, researches, designs and develops metallic materials and their related fabrication and application processes to develop and optimize materials for use in engineering design of and/or application in structures, systems and subsystems Applies principles of chemistry, physics, and material behavior to develop metallic processing specifications, fabrication and assembly processes Develops, analyzes and applies material properties and design allowables, processing processes and quality engineering specifications Material analyses, including failure analysis of components, systems and subsystems, life predictions, and definition and requirement specifications Leads Tiger Team efforts in RCCAs related to metallurgical issues, presenting status to stakeholders and customers Perform drawing reviews to ensure M&P requirements are satisfied As a full-time employee of Northrop Grumman Space Systems, you are eligible for our robust benefits package including: Medical, Dental & Vision coverage 401k Educational Assistance Life Insurance Employee Assistance Programs & Work/Life Solutions Paid Time Off Health & Wellness Resources Employee Discounts This position’s standard work schedule is a 9/80. The 9/80 schedule allows employees who work a nine-hour day Monday through Thursday to take every other Friday off. Basic Qualifications: Bachelor of Science (BS) in a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) discipline with a minimum of 8 years of experience with a background in metallic materials; OR a Master of Science (MS) degree in a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) discipline with a minimum of 6 years of experience with a background in metallic materials. Experience with metal fabrication and design Experience with repair processes for metal materials Experience with the qualification of metals or metallurgical processes Experience with material selection Preferred Qualifications: Your ability to obtain and/or transfer and maintain the final adjudicated government clearance, and any program access(es) required for the position within a reasonable period of time, as determined by the company. Master’s Degree in discipline of Materials Science or similar Subject Matter Expertise in one of the following areas: Metals joining (soldering, brazing, or welding), forgings, advanced material selection, or heat treatment.
